Statute of Limitations

The statute of limitations is a time period within which a lawsuit against negligent asbestos producers has to be filed. The clock starts ticking once the victim or their family members discover they suffer from an asbestos-related illness, so it is important to act as soon as you can.

A successful asbestos lawsuit can help the victim or their family members for their losses. This can include medical bills, homecare expenses as well as lost wages and quality of life as well as funeral and burial expenses. Mesothelioma patients may also be eligible for compensation for suffering and pain, mental anguish, and loss of consortium.

In some states the statute of limitations begins at the point that a person develops symptoms of an illness linked to asbestos like mesothelioma, asbestosis, or lung cancer. But mesothelioma can take decades to develop, which means that many asbestos victims don't realize they have a mesothelioma diagnosis until after the statute of limitations has passed. This is why it is essential to speak with an asbestos attorney as soon as possible.

Asbestos litigation is a complicated area and there are a variety of factors that can influence the statute of limitations. The location of asbestos exposure or the employer's location will determine the state statute of limitations that applies to a case. In addition, victims who have been diagnosed with more than one asbestos-related disease may be subject to different statutes of limitation.

It is therefore important to consult with an asbestos lawyer to ensure you don't miss the deadline for filing an action. A knowledgeable lawyer will assist you in determining which legal options are best for your situation. Additionally, they will do their best to reach an acceptable settlement. If no agreement is reached, they will be ready to bring your case to trial.

Asbestos victims may also want to look into making a claim to recover compensation through an asbestos trust fund. These funds are set up by companies who once manufactured asbestos products in order to cover victims' medical expenses, compensation, and other damages. Your asbestos lawyer will be able determine if your potential claim can be submitted to an asbestos trust fund and assist you with the process.

Asbestos Litigation in New York

New York is one of the most important states in asbestos litigation. The state is third nationally for the number of asbestos cases filed and second for mesothelioma-specific claims. Asbestos-related diseases can develop for years after exposure and may cause catastrophic complications, such as mesothelioma and lung cancer as well as asbestosis.

Asbestos victims need an experienced New York attorney to help them file a claim, obtain proper medical care and fight for the compensation they are due. A lawyer can provide emotional support to guide you through this difficult period.

Weitz & Luxenberg has a successful track record of asbestos litigation. The firm was established in 1986 and has since grown to be an unmatched legal force. Their lawyers are highly educated and compassionate. They are dedicated to helping those suffering from asbestos-related illnesses and their families get the compensation they deserve.

Asbestos lawsuits are different from the typical personal injury case. These cases are usually complex and require an expert understanding of asbestos laws, regulations and procedures. In addition, the plaintiffs are usually suffering from serious illnesses like mesothelioma or asbestos-related illnesses that require speedier filing of their claims.

In New York, defendants often have difficulty defending summary judgement motions against mesothelioma allegations. Prior to the recent rulings in Nemeth, Parker and Juni, defendants were unable to win these motions based solely on the testimony of experts by plaintiffs as insufficient to prove causation specific.

These recent rulings offer New York asbestos defense lawyers some hope. In three separate cases the Appellate Division, First Department overturned and dismissed summary judgments against tile manufacturers for their failure to produce counter-expert testimony with the amount of friable asbestos fibers present in their products.

The cases were ruled on by Justice Sherry Klein Heitler in NYCAL. Heitler has been in charge of the NYCAL docket since 2008, when she took over from former Assembly Speaker Sheldon Silver after his conviction on federal corruption charges of accepting referral fees from Weitz & Luxenberg to steer asbestos lawsuits to her company. The NYCAL cases are consolidated to streamline the trial process.

Filing Your Claim

A successful asbestos claim can pay victims for medical expenses, lost income and suffering. It may also cover funeral costs and other financial losses.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ist a victim and their family make an asbestos lawsuit, or pursue compensation through other legal avenues, including trust funds or veterans' benefits from the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A).

To be eligible for a mesothelioma settlement it is necessary to provide thorough documentation of the diagnosis and your experience with asbestos. This includes medical records, employment records, and witness statements. Mesothelioma attorneys collaborate with specialists who can look over these records and ensure they are as strong as they can be to support a lawsuit.

A skilled asbestos lawyer will begin the lawsuit process by drafting a document called a complaint. This document, or an pleading, details the legal grounds for the lawsuit, and names asbestos companies as defendants. The document also includes the details of all your injuries and losses.

In many states there is an expiration date that imposes a deadline on asbestos lawsuits. Your attorney will provide you with the deadlines in your state to ensure that you don't miss any crucial dates. They will also discuss the options available to receive compensation, which includes workers' compensation benefits as well as VA benefits.

After the pleading has been filed the lawyer will conduct additional research to support your case and gather evidence. This could involve interviewing your coworkers, looking over the employment history you have and locating asbestos-related companies that may be responsible for your exposure.

In addition, your lawyer can help you file a claim using asbestos trust funds set up by bankruptcy asbestos companies. These funds may assist you in obtaining compensation without going to court.

Asbestos sufferers are diagnosed with various illnesses including mesothelioma and lung cancer. These diseases have a lengthy latency period, meaning that it is possible that exposure to asbestos happened decades ago.
